OpenMRBenelux / openmrb2021-hackathon

3 stars 1 forks source link

fMRwhy: BIDS-compatible multi-echo fMRI analysis and quality control with SPM12/MATLAB/Octave #4

Open jsheunis opened 3 years ago

jsheunis commented 3 years ago

fMRwhy: BIDS-compatible multi-echo fMRI analysis and quality control with SPM12/MATLAB/Octave

fmrwhy

Project Description

With this hackathon I would like to onboard anyone who wants to join, contribute to, or learn more about the fMRwhy project: a toolbox for BIDS-compatible multi-echo fMRI analysis and data quality control with SPM12/MATLAB/Octave.

You can access more information about the toolbox here:

If you go through the documentation and code base you will notice that many aspects are lacking, poorly implemented, undocumented, and more. That's why the project is at a great stage to receive contributions, from updates to the documentation to setting up a testing framework.

Specific goal

During the weeks before the hackathon, I will create specific issues on the fMRwhy GitHub repo that will guide new contributors. These issues will likely relate to the following aspects that require improvement:

Skills required to participate

Anyone who wants to contribute should be able to contribute. There are, however, some required skills depending on the features that you'd like to contribute to:

Specific levels of requirement for if you want to contribute to specific software features include:

language level of expertise required
MATLAB beginner / confirmed / expert
javascript confirmed / expert
html confirmed / expert
css confirmed / expert
SPM beginner / confirmed / expert
GIT - 2 comfortable working with branches and can do a pull request on another repository

If you don't have the required skills but are keen to acquire them while contributing, please feel free to reach out!

Integration

How would your project integrate a physicist/imager/clinician/psychologist/computational scientist/maker/artist/lawyer as collaborator?

...to be determined...

Preparation material

Link to your GitHub repo

fMRwhy on GitHub

Communication

Mattermost chat

Remi-Gau commented 3 years ago

@jsheunis

I might drop by to help you get started to set up unit tests, code coverage and CI for those if you want? :-)

jsheunis commented 3 years ago

That would be awesome!

Remi-Gau commented 3 years ago

A channel for this project was added in the openMR 2021 discord server